Today Desiree Pilgrim-Hunter announced the support of 20 community leaders from the 33rd Senate District. The diverse and influential group jointly recognized Desiree as a “trusted community leader” with a “strong record of standing up for the people of this district.”
Collectively, the group also affirmed their support for Desiree’s “vision for making a fresh start in the Northwest Bronx.”
The list below includes leaders of tenant associations representing hundreds of people in the district, community-based organizations, and prominent religious institutions in the Northwest Bronx.
